A sensitization program on the usage of Siemens’ Centre of Excellence was held today 01-08-2018, for all AP-Engineering College Principals, by APSSDC.

The Principals of various engineering colleges across AP were addressed by Dr.B.Nageswara rao, Project Director, APSSDC -Siemens Project, Dr. Ghanta Subbarao, Special Secretary, Skill Development, Entrepreneurship & Innovation Department, Govt. of AP, Dr.K. Lakshmi Narayana IAS (Retd), Founder Director, APSSDC, Prof. S RamaKrishna Garu, Vice Chancellor I/C, JNTU Kakinada.

The meeting aimed at the skill development of AP students and the usage of Siemens Centre of Excellence in achieving that. Dr. B.Nageswar Rao, Project Director, APSSDC-Siemens Project, while addressing the academicians, stated that, the Siemens CoE at VVIT is on par with the global standards.  He uttered that this APSSDC founded Siemens CoE has better state-of-the-art laboratory facilities than that of many International Universities. Sri Nageswar Rao did a comparative analysis of various CoEs at Hyderabad and different places in India and explained how the Siemens CoE at VVIT was superior to all of them.

Prof Ghanta Subba Rao, Special Secretary, Skill Development, Entrepreneurship & Innovation Department, Govt. of AP, briefed upon the facilities at 40 different centres of excellences in India and suggested all Engineering Colleges to utilize it to its best.

Dr.K. Lakshmi Narayana IAS (Retd), Founder Director, APSSDC, emphasized that the role of teachers is major in the skill development of students and cited that the country Finland gives the highest importance to teachers. Sri Lakshmi Narayana stated that a teacher can bring revolutionary changes in the society and generations through his teachings. He urged all teaching community to be more interactive with students and yield necessary skill development in them.

Prof. S RamaKrishna Garu, Vice Chancellor I/C, JNTU Kakinada, stated that by utilizing the facilities at the APSSDC Siemens CoE, all engineering colleges can hone the skills of their students and urged all Principals to utilize meticulously.

Sri Vasireddy Vidya Sagar, Chairman of Vasireddy Venkatadri Institute of Technology informed it is a greatest privilege for the VVIT to host the APSSDC Siemen’s CoE and opined that all educational institutions will utilize it for prosperity among the student fraternity.

The chef-de-officials of APSSDC also chalked out feasibilities of providing training for the students of different engineering colleges. The team of principals visited VVIT’s APSSDC-SIEMENS-COE. The team interacted the VVIT Siemens COE lab trainers, Management members and acquired the information about the structural layout, functionality and various financial & training related aspects of COE labs, inquisitively.
   
The principals of various engineering colleges commended the efforts of Andhra Pradesh State Skill Development Corporation (APSSDC) for establishing this world-class Siemens Centre of Excellence Laboratories. They also appreciated VVIT for its praise-worthy maintenance, to achieve its highest objectives of training the youth to make them highly skilled.
